ASTM A249 TP304 Base Tube Composition
Grade | UNS Designation | C | Mn | P | S | Si | Ch | Ni | Mo | Other |
TP304 | S30400 | 0.08 | 2 | 0.045 | 0.03 | 1 | 18.0–20.0 | 8.0–11.0 | ... | ... |
A249 TP304 L Type Wound Fin Tube Strength
- Excellent corrosion resistance: Stainless steel material has a strong corrosion resistance, suitable for a variety of harsh environments.
- Efficient heat exchange: The L-fin design increases the surface area and helps to improve heat exchange efficiency, suitable for heating and cooling systems.
- High temperature resistance: Stainless steel can maintain performance under high temperature conditions, suitable for high temperature fluid applications.
- Strength and durability: Stainless steel has good mechanical strength and durability, and can withstand greater pressure and impact.
- Easy to clean and maintain: Smooth surfaces make cleaning easier and reduce the risk of fouling and bacterial growth.
- Space saving: The L-shaped design makes installation more flexible and suitable for applications where space is limited.
- Environmental protection: Stainless steel material can be recycled, in line with environmental requirements.
